2 Muslims are currently the largest religious minority in Western Europe. This presence of Islam in Europe is a direct consequence of the existence of pathways of immigration (that opened up in the early 1960s) leading from the Western States' former colonies in Asia, Africa, and the Caribbean. Fasting during the month of Ramadan is one of the five pillars of Islam, a recurring annual ritual, which is passionately practiced by most Muslims across the world. It is obligatory on every healthy Muslim; however, the Qur’an and Islamic teachings specifically exempt people with acute or chronic illnesses from this duty, especially if it might have harmful consequences.
